两台机器,linux和数据库
linux连接数据库作为OB的一个租户。
我在上面完成建库,建表,但是在需要导入数据时碰到一个问题。
数据文件我放在linux上,但是输入指令LOAD DATA LOCAL INFILE '/tmp/.csv’ INTO TABLE dbo. FIELDS TERMINATED BY ‘,’ LINES TERMINATED BY ‘\r\n’ IGNORE 1 ROWS;后显示错误:ERROR 1235(0A000):LOAD data local not supported
1 个赞
将csv文件放到数据库所在的节点试试呢
2 个赞
我只是一个租户,可以使用数据库,但不代表我可以使用数据库所在的服务器吧
1 个赞
ob版本是多少
支持load data local语法版本在423与430之后
1 个赞
4.2.1.1
1 个赞
421版本不支持load data local语法。csv数据文件必须放在observer端
2 个赞
如何是版本问题,那较低版本的该如何进行这个需求的实现?
2 个赞
租户可以放文件到数据库端吗?
1 个赞
如果你没有主机权限,找主机侧运维同事帮忙把文件拷贝到数据库所在的机器上吧
2 个赞
有没有一种可能,用obloader能满足你的要求?
2 个赞
学习学习
具体说说怎么操作,我去试试